Summary
Diagnosing infants with cough and wheezing is challenging due to intertwined cardiac and pulmonary diseases. Congenital heart conditions can mimic lung issues, potentially delaying critical treatment.
Area of Science:
- Pediatric Cardiology
- Pulmonology
- Neonatology
Background:
- Cardiac and pulmonary diseases present complex diagnostic challenges in infants.
- Differentiating primary pulmonary issues from cardiac causes of respiratory symptoms is crucial.
Observation:
- Wheezing infants statistically often have primary pulmonary disease.
- Congenital cardiac abnormalities can present with pulmonary symptoms, leading to misdiagnosis.
- Vascular rings compressing the trachea can cause cough and wheezing.
- Left-to-right shunts (e.g., VSD, PDA) can cause bronchial compression and pulmonary venous congestion.
- Other cardiac lesions like anomalous pulmonary venous return can cause obstructive symptoms.
Findings:
- Failure to identify the primary cardiac or pulmonary cause can lead to life-threatening delays and procedures.
- Congenital heart defects can manifest as significant pulmonary symptoms, complicating diagnosis.
- Specific cardiac anomalies directly cause or mimic respiratory distress in infants.
Implications:
- Accurate diagnosis is vital to prevent unnecessary interventions and ensure timely, appropriate treatment.
- Understanding the cardiac origins of respiratory symptoms in infants is critical for pediatricians.
- Early recognition of cardiac disease in wheezing infants can improve patient outcomes.
